Barnes & Noble has successfully revitalized its business by focusing on its physical stores rather than solely enhancing e-commerce. The company, once struggling, has embraced a model inspired by indie booksellers, allowing each store to cater to its local community. This approach has led to the opening of 60 new stores in 2025, with plans for more in 2026. By empowering local employees to curate their offerings and engage with customers through social media and events, Barnes & Noble has transformed its stores into meaningful community spaces, moving away from traditional retail strategies.
